How to Use the Kit

Download Files for Digital Use: This kit includes files you can download to market Handshake to your target audience at the University of Minnesota. You are free to make edits to add unit/college/campus specific branding, but please do not edit original files. Rather, download the design file, or if working in Google Drive, save a copy (right click on a file and select “Make a Copy”) and work off the copied version.

Print Marketing Material: We ask that each career unit take care of their own printing needs. Other departments, please contact handshake@umn.edu if you would like Handshake posters, postcards, or business cards.

  • Suggested printing vendors: We have used and recommend UMN Printing Services, FedEx, and GotPrint. GotPrint tends to have the lowest prices while UMN Printing Services provides great quality.

For questions, contact handshake@umn.edu.

Marketing Blurbs

25 words: Handshake is a career network for students, alumni, and employers with local, national, and international opportunities.

50 words: Handshake is a career network for students, alumni, and employers with local, national, and international opportunities. Students have access to search and apply for part-time jobs, internships, co-ops, and full-time career opportunities

100 words: Handshake is a career network for students, alumni, and employers with local, national, and international opportunities. Students have access to search and apply for part-time jobs, internships, co-ops, and full-time career opportunities, as well as search for information on upcoming career fairs and on-campus recruiting events. Register for career events, fairs, and interviews and chat and network with employers directly through Handshake.
